What is the opportunity?
As Senior Manager Loan Portfolio Management, Business Credit you responsible for designing and executing a transformational, proactive approach to manage the Canadian business credit. You will gather data and analyze same to drive consistent portfolio management activities, governance, and reporting across Sales, GRM, CB Operations, Finance, and National Office groups. Additionally monitor portfolio trends to identify both areas of concern and potential growth opportunities and recommend appropriate actions to implement or mitigate as applicable.
What will you do?
- Design, development, and implementation of a robust end to end loan portfolio management process across the Commercial Banking lending portfolio.
- Use of best-in-class tools to streamline and optimize management routines to maximize discovery and deep analytics, while minimize reporting overheads (i.e., reduce time spend getting data to maximize time spend understanding information & sharing with senior management)
- Collaborates closely with stakeholders across Commercial Banking (GRM, Sales Enablement, Finance, Operations, other National Office Groups) to ensure alignment of portfolio definitions and segmentations to minimize reporting discrepancies across Commercial Banking and proactive participation to portfolio review committee comprised of senior executives in Commercial Banking and GRM.
- Monitoring emerging trends in portfolio quality with a deep understanding of commercial industry sector and regional differences, and different monitoring approaches based on size of exposures
- Seeks understanding of portfolio trends, opportunities and threats, and advice key stakeholders toward their better understanding of such trends/opportunities/threats.
- Seeks out industry trends and organization knowledge to understand alternative approaches / solutions to portfolio issues identified
- Enhance Business Credit loan portfolio management capabilities and develop specialized analytic capabilities through appropriate technologies (e.g., Python, SAS, SQL, Tableau, Power BI)
What do you need to succeed?
Must-have
- 7-10 years’ experience working with complex and large data structures, preferably in a Business/Credit information environment
- Strong system/software technical skills to make optimal use of the bank’s complex database infrastructure including intermediate/advanced Python, SQL, Power BI, and Tableau.
- Knowledge of BFS credit products, policies, and procedures, preferably working closely with, or in, GRM
- Strong foundation and extensive experience with designing and building complex portfolio monitoring systems utilizing leading-edge tools and techniques
- Superior analytical skills with ability to analyze trends, provide insight and uncover information
- Strategic mindset and vision for sound portfolio management practices with proven ability to act proactively and independently
Nice-to-have
- Proven competency in planning, organization, and project management
- Experience with SQL Server and Teradata/Data Lake infrastructures
